This is the complete 14-volume set of sermons on Romans by D. Martyn Lloyd-Jones. All over the world in the most diverse situations are to be found Christian men and women who owe an incalculable debt to the ministry of Dr. D. Martyn Lloyd-Jones who for thirty years was the minister of Westminster Chapel, London. His longest series of expositions was this 14-volume set on Romans, the greatest of New Testament Epistles.
Just as Lloyd-Jones’ public ministry stood out as widely different from contemporary preaching, so his Romans came into bookshops with an appeal that took many by surprise. Not a few thought that the nature of his pulpit ministry would inhibit its continuance on paper – ‘He needed to be heard, not read.’ But those of that opinion were mistaking where his real strength lay. First of all, it lay in the truth he was speaking, not in its delivery. Further, his whole view of preaching meant that he addressed himself to the heart and conscience, as well as to the mind, and sermonic material of that kind has never failed to hold readers as well as hearers. Time was to prove that his message would reach far larger numbers by his books than had ever been possible even in his widespread ministry.
Lloyd-Jones’ books would also go into many languages and his Romans would be read by thousands, in nations from Brazil to Korea.
Contents
- Romans 1: The Gospel of God
- Romans 2:1-3:20: The Righteous Judgment of God
- Romans 3:20-4:25: Atonement & Justification
- Romans 5: Assurance
- Romans 6: The New Man
- Romans 7:1-8:4: The Law: Its Functions and Limits
- Romans 8:5-17: The Sons of God
- Romans 8:17-39: Final Perseverance
- Romans 9: God’s Sovereign Purpose
- Romans 10: Saving Faith
- Romans 11: To God’s Glory
- Romans 12: Christian Conduct
- Romans 13: Life in Two Kingdoms
- Romans 14: Liberty and Conscience
About the Author
Martyn Lloyd-Jones (1899-1981), minister of Westminster Chapel in London for 30 years, was one of the foremost preachers of his day. His many books have brought profound spiritual encouragement to millions around the world.
